Parity word denotes number of 1’s in a … Web17 Jun 2024 · So as there are 8 bytes, and one bit of every byte is used for parity, each byte has 7 bits used in the cipher itself. There are 64 / 8 = 8 bytes with 7 bits each, 8 * 7 = 56 bits effective key size. This circuit can be an even parity checker or parity checker … WebBit 32 is the parity bit, and is used to verify that the word was not damaged or garbled during transmission. Every ARINC 429 channel typically uses "odd" parity - there must be an odd number of "1" bits in the word. This bit is set to 0 or 1 to ensure that the correct number of bits are set to 1 in the word.
